## Artifact Signing — Liftwise Simulator Builds

Every release of the Liftwise elevator-dispatch simulator ships as a signed bundle. Support staff helping customers install a build should confirm the signature matches before troubleshooting anything else — most "corrupt install" reports turn out to be unsigned mirrors. Use the `liftwise verify` command on the downloaded bundle. The command checks the bundle against our published key, included below for reference.

signing key of bagap-yawep = bky13_TbfT6ZMUoGJo2

Nightfall runs the nightly data backfills for the Corvane analytics platform. Three environments exist: dev (ad-hoc runs only), staging (mirrors production schedules at reduced concurrency), and production (full backfill window, 01:00–05:00 local). Each environment has isolated credentials and its own dead-letter queue; no cross-environment job submission is permitted. Schedules are locked by change control in production. For reference during review, the production environment currently operates with the following configuration.

settings of yahaf-tahop:
jorox:
  pin: 5851
  tenant: noveth
  seal: seal_7ddb5c42
  metrics_host: metrics.jorox.ordinnet.example
  standby_team: wenax
  escalation: oliath-feneth
  nonce: 552548

**Ticket: SnapSentry config drift on the preview runners**

Hey, on-call friend. Our snapshot tests for the Larkspur UI components started flaking this morning, and it's not the components — it's drift. The preview runners in the Tellinghast pool are rendering with different viewport and font settings than CI, so every snapshot diff lights up red. Someone hand-edited a runner last sprint and never synced it back. Please reconcile the runners so they match the canonical settings below:

settings of tagef-bawif:
DRUIX_HOST=druix.zemvarlabs.internal
DRUIX_PORT=8000

Subject: Key rotation ahead of ORM refactor

Team,

As we continue refactoring the legacy Quillstone ORM layer in Fennec, we're rotating the credential used by the schema-diff service before Thursday's sync. The old key is entangled with hardcoded mappings in the deprecated adapter, so please verify your local branches read from the shared config rather than the checked-in constants. Mira will walk through the migration plan at the sync. The new key for the schema-diff service is below.

app token of yajof-fajof = zpat11_OrsDd3gqCaG